Cantine Riunite & Civ

Cantine Riunite & CIV has launched a project to innovate water management at its Glera vineyard in Carlino (55 ha), with the goal of optimizing nutrition and irrigation, improving plant protection, and reducing inputs with a view toward environmental and economic sustainability. The project required an underground system that is fully automated and can be managed remotely.

Client requirements

It was necessary to install a comprehensive and reliable irrigation system for 55 ha of vineyards, with the following specific requirements:
  • full automation and Remote monitoring and control of the system from headquarters;
  • underground infrastructure to minimize interference with the vineyard;
  • independent water supply via an artesian well;
  • a submersible pump and a pressurization system sized to ensure constant flow rate and pressure;
  • Valve opening system and remote communication (GPRS) for centralized management.

Idroelettrica's proposal

Following a site inspection and technical-geological analysis, Idroelettrica proposed and built a turnkey plant that included the following supplies and construction work:
  • drilling and construction of an artesian well for local water supply;
  • supply and installation of an 11-kW submersible pump (flow rate 30 m³/h at 4 atm);
  • control panel with an inverter and pressure transducer for precise control of the flow rate and system protection;
  • main line maintained under constant pressure by a 300-liter pressure tank;
  • installation of underground pipes and fittings for the entire irrigation network;
  • supply of the valve-opening transmission system, complete with transmitters, receivers, electrical components, and an antenna;
  • GPRS system integration with a SIM card and modem for remote monitoring and control from a remote station (Campegine, RE);
  • Management of geological procedures and on-site commissioning for system calibration and optimization.

The result

The system has enabled full automation and Remote monitoring and control of irrigation for the 55-hectare vineyard. The customer can now remotely control and monitor all irrigation operations, optimizing water use, reducing energy consumption thanks to the inverter, and improving the agronomic and phytosanitary sustainability of the crops.
